Generation of sub-two-cycle CEP-stable optical pulses at 3.5 μm by multiple-plate pulse compression for high-harmonic generation in crystals
- 1. The institute for Solid State Physics, the University of Tokyo, 5-1-5 Kashiwanoha, Kashiwa 277-8581 (Japan)
Description
Multiple-plate pulse compression of femtosecond mid-infrared pulses is demonstrated using YAG and Si windows. With this robust compression scheme, we produce sub-two-cycle, CEP-stable optical pulses and observe CEP-dependent high harmonic generation in crystals.
